City Council Sustainability Procurement Policy

Last year the Flagstaff City Council made a bad decision when it renewed the city’s contract with Wells Fargo Bank, a corrupt and dirty bank. The decision went against the Flagstaff City Council’s goal of net zero emissions by 2030. The city’s contract with Wells Fargo expires in June 2025, which means the city is required to issue a new request for proposals for a servicing bank.

Since the city council's terrible decision last year, Fossil Free Arizona has been advocating that the city update the city purchasing policy so climate change can be a factor that the city can consider when it evaluates proposals from applicants who want to be the city’s next servicing bank. We have reached a pivotal point in this effort. The Flagstaff City Council will discuss proposed amendments to the procurement code at its work session on MAY 28th at 3:00 at city hall.
